Covered Patios and Lighting: Why It's Trickier Than It Looks
You have a pergola, awning, or open sunroom, and you want to light it without digging trenches or calling an electrician. Good news: it's totally possible. Bad news: most people make a beginner's mistake that ruins their project from the start.
Here's the real problem. A covered patio blocks sunlight. That's precisely what makes it pleasant in summer — but it also complicates solar lighting. Placing a solar light directly under a roof dooms its panel to permanent shade. The battery won't charge, and the light won't turn on. This isn't a product quality issue; it's a placement issue.
This guide provides real solutions for covered patio lighting based on your setup: pergola with pillars, wall-mounted awning, or partially enclosed sunroom. Each time, we'll give you the method that actually works.
The 3 Types of Covered Patios — and How They Affect Lighting
Before choosing a solution, you need to understand your setup. Not all covered patios are alike, and lighting constraints vary greatly between types.
The Pergola with Free-Standing Pillars
This is the most favorable scenario. The pergola rests on pillars extending from the ground, and these pillars are accessible from all sides. You can mount a light on the outer pillar, high up, so the solar panel slightly extends beyond the roof and captures direct light. This is the ideal setup for a solar pergola light, provided you choose the right location.
The rule: the solar panel must see the sky. If you mount the light halfway up a north-facing pillar, you'll limit the charge. Placing it at the top of a south-facing pillar, slightly angled upwards, makes all the difference.
The Wall-Mounted or Ceiling-Mounted Awning
Patio awning, overhanging roof, open sunroom roof... In this case, the structure is often attached to the house. Pillars are less common, and the roof extends directly overhead. This is where under awning solar lighting becomes tricky: the panel is inevitably under the roof.
The solution: either a USB rechargeable light (we'll get back to that), or a light with a cable connecting the panel and the light body — but these models are still rare and often expensive. For most awning situations, USB recharging is the most reliable answer.
The Enclosed or Partially Glazed Sunroom
Let's be direct: if your patio is an entirely enclosed sunroom with glass, solar power won't work correctly. Standard solar panels don't charge through glass — or not sufficiently to keep a battery charged. In this case, USB rechargeable lighting is the only viable wireless alternative, or you'll need to consider traditional electrical wiring.
The #1 Mistake to Never Make with a Solar Light Under a Pergola
Mounting a solar light directly under a pergola roof is the most common — and most frustrating — mistake. The light turns on for the first few days (the battery is factory-charged), then gradually dims until it stops working. Many people then assume the product is defective. In reality, the solar panel is in the shade all day and cannot do its job.
For pergola lighting that actually works, there's no secret: the panel must receive direct sunlight for several hours a day. This means placing it out of the roof's shadow, typically on a pillar, high enough for the panel to emerge above the cover.

Practical Solutions for Lighting a Covered Patio Without Wires
Several approaches exist depending on your setup. Here are the most effective, with their honest pros and cons.
Option 1: Solar Light Mounted on the Outer Pergola Pillar
This is the best solution for a pergola with pillars. The principle: you mount the light not under the roof, but on the outer face of a pillar, high enough so the solar panel is clear of the roofline. The light projects its illumination into the patio, and the panel freely captures sunlight.
Things to check before buying:
- The light must have adjustable orientation — panel towards the sky, light towards the patio.
- The light's IP rating must be suitable for outdoor use (IP65 minimum to resist rain and frost).
- The motion sensor's range must cover your entire patio area from the pillar.

Option 2: USB Rechargeable LED Light Bar for Under Awning Lighting
When solar isn't practical — low awning, structure without accessible pillars, or sunroom — the USB rechargeable light bar is your best friend. You plug it into a charger about once a month, and it provides light without wires or electrical installation.
The advantage for a covered patio: you mount it exactly where you want, without solar panel constraints. Under the awning, along a beam, or at the ceiling edge. The motion sensor does the rest.

Option 3: Solar or Rechargeable String Lights
For ambiance, string lights remain a popular option. Solar models work well if you can place the panel in a sunny area — attached to a post outside the roof's shadow, placed on the garden-facing railing, or on top of a pillar. Rechargeable string lights eliminate this constraint but require periodic recharging.
Their limitation: they provide ambiance but little functional light. It's difficult to read, cook, or see clearly with string lights alone. They combine well with a main solution like a motion-sensing light.
Option 4: Wired Lighting — When It's the Right Answer
If you already have an electrical outlet on or near your patio, wired lighting remains a reliable option. Adjustable spotlights, wall sconces, LED strips recessed into the structure... The possibilities are numerous, and the result can be very high-quality. The constraint: it often requires an electrician, and outdoor cables must be protected.
For many people, wireless remains more practical and less expensive — especially for renters or those who want to avoid renovation work.

How to Choose the Right Location for a Solar Pergola Light
Placement is everything. Two identical lights can yield radically different results depending on where you mount them. Here are the criteria to check before drilling anything.
What Exposure for the Solar Panel?
South orientation remains the standard in North America. A south-facing panel receives maximum sunlight throughout the year, including in winter when the sun is low. East or west work but reduce daily charge. North should be avoided at all costs.
Tilt also matters. A flat panel captures less effectively than a panel slightly angled towards the sun. If your light allows you to adjust the panel's angle independently of the light head, take advantage of it.

How High to Mount the Light on the Pillar?
In practice, mounting the light between 7.2 and 9.2 feet (2.20 m and 2.80 m) high generally yields the best results. High enough for the panel to clear the pergola's roofline (depending on its height), and low enough for the motion sensor to effectively cover the traffic area.
If your pergola roof is particularly high, you may need to mount the light just below the roof/pillar junction, with the panel slightly above the roof level. A few inches of clearance are often sufficient.
How to Check if the Panel Will Get Enough Sun?
A simple method: observe the shadow cast on the pillar around 1 PM in mid-summer. If the pillar is in shadow, the roof is too wide for the panel to be clear at that height. Move it higher or choose another more exposed pillar.
In winter, the sun is lower in the sky. The shadow of a pergola roof at noon in January can be significantly longer than in July. This is a factor to anticipate if you live in northern regions or if your pergola is unfavorably oriented.
Covered Patio Lighting: Balancing Light Output
A covered patio isn't a parking lot to be lit with 5000 lumens. The goal is often to combine safety (seeing where you walk), comfort (reading, eating, chatting), and ambiance (a pleasant evening). These three uses don't have the same needs.
What Light Output for a Standard Covered Patio?
For a partially covered patio of 160 to 320 sq ft (15 to 30 m²), a light between 800 and 1200 lumens is generally sufficient for functional lighting in motion detection mode. This is equivalent to a good household bulb, concentrated where you need it.

Motion Detection Mode or Continuous Mode: Which to Choose for a Patio?
Motion detection mode is suitable for security lighting and pathways: the light turns on when you arrive, and turns off a few seconds later. Practical, economical, discreet.
Continuous mode is useful when you're relaxing on the patio for an extended evening. The light stays on without you having to wave your arms to reactivate it. Some lights offer both modes with a simple button press.
For mixed use (nighttime security + evening comfort), the best option is a light that offers both easily switchable modes.
What No One Tells You About Solar Lighting on a Covered Patio
Some practical realities often omitted in commercial guides.
Partial shading degrades more than you think. An hour of direct shade on a solar panel in the middle of the day can reduce daily charge much more than proportionally. If your pillar is in shade from 11 AM to 2 PM, you're missing the heart of the peak charging period.
Snow and dirt matter. In winter, a panel covered with snow or leaves won't charge. This is especially true for panels with a shallow angle. Choose a light with an adjustable panel that's easily accessible for an occasional wipe-down.
Battery capacity makes a difference in winter. In summer, even a small battery recharges easily every day. In winter, with less sun and longer nights, a large-capacity battery truly makes a difference. For Renters: Lighting Your Covered Patio Without Renovation Permits
Are you renting and have a covered patio? Good news: wireless and no-drill solutions are perfectly suited to your situation. No cables, no trenches, no holes in the walls.
Industrial adhesive or magnetic mounting is sufficient for most modern lights and light bars. You install it, and remove it at the end of your lease without leaving a trace. This is one of the most frequently cited arguments by users of these solutions.
The only limit: if your landlord has restrictions on modifying facades or pillars, check your contract terms. For a simple light mounted with adhesive, it's usually not a problem — but it's worth checking.
